Barbecue Sauce % cup salad oil 1 tablespoon salt 1 cup cider vinegar 1 teaspoon Tabasco sauce 2 tablespoons molasses Combine ingredients in a covered jar and shake well before using. When broiling fish on a barbecue, use this sauce for basting. Turn fish occasionally and baste several times. Makes about 14 cups sauce or enough for 3 pounds of fish. Topping for Fillets 14 cup mayonnaise 1 tablespoon chopped pimiento 2 tablespoons finely chopped green 1 tablespoon lemon juice onion Combine all ingredients. Spread over fillets before baking. Makes sauce for 1 pound of fillets.
